Another bash from Google?
Despite security concerns, internet users' insatiable appetite for social networking sites shows no signs of abating with rumours that Google seeks to topple Facebook's crown with its own proposition.
Speculative reports of a new network called ‘Google Me' are rife, with ex Facebook CTO, Adam D'Angelo entering the debate via Q&A service, Quora.
He says Google Me is ‘not a rumour' and the search giant is building a full social network based on Facebook, to be launched as soon as possible.
"They [Google] had assumed that Facebook's growth would slow as it grew, and that Facebook wouldn't be able to have too much leverage over them, but then it just didn't stop, and now they are really scared," he added.
However, no matter how wonderful the rumoured proposition might be, Google certainly have some catching up to do before they total 500m users, like Facebook.
